Vandoorne remaining positive despite pre-season testing dramas

Stoffel Vandoorne believes it is an honour for him to be part of the McLaren Honda Formula 1 Team, and says any young driver would love to be a part of one of the legendary teams of the sport if asked. The Belgian will make his full-time Formula 1 debut in 2017 alongside Fernando Alonso after making a one-off appearance last year at the Bahrain Grand Prix, scoring a point for tenth place, and he is excited about his future at the Woking-based team. “For me it is still a very exciting time to join McLaren-Honda, even though the results are maybe not where we want them to be,” said Vandoorne to Formula1.com. “I think every young driver would say ‘yes' in an instant if...
